Cyprus Unemployment Rate Rises Slightly: Implications for Markets and Investors


Unemployment Rate Overview

On March 4, 2025, Cyprus reported a modest increase in its unemployment rate, reaching 5% from the previous 4.9%, surpassing the forecast of 4.5%. While the impact is rated as low, the 2.041% change may still have subtle implications for both local and global markets.

Implications for Cyprus and Global Markets

The rise in unemployment signals a slight cooling in Cyprus’s economic activity. Although the change is marginal, sustained increases could indicate underlying economic challenges that may affect consumer spending and overall economic growth. On a global scale, this report provides insight into the labor market’s health within the European Union and can serve as a microcosm for investors to gauge economic trends in smaller economies.
